Mine's just had its 20,000 mile service. I asked about getting the software updated and got a phone call to say that they would charge for it. In the end they did it but I'm not sure it it's because the lease company agreed to pay it or Bmw customer service agreed due to a snotty email I sent. So in SAVE mode instead of stopping at 53% it now keeps on charging, but I can't see any other changes with the software.
My company is very short sighted and won't pay for a charger or my electric so I refuse to charge at home on principal as I already pay tax on free private fuel, so it doesn't often get fully charged, but over 20000 miles I'm getting 41.6mpg which for such a great performance I don't think is bad but I'm normal a fairly steady driver. I've had no issues at all ( although a friend that has the same car had to top up coolant twice and has done less miles) so all in all very pleased even if it is only the basic model.
